Older Redmine releases could expose sensitive information through an Atom feed. For organizations using Redmine to track projects, issues, or security work, this could disclose internal activity that users should not see. The public bundle does not show active exploitation or a CVSS score. Exposure is most likely in internet-facing or broadly accessible Redmine instances running the affected legacy versions, especially where Atom feeds are enabled or reachable. The bundle does not identify other affected products. Treat this as a legacy Redmine exposure requiring prompt remediation if Redmine is still deployed. Urgency rises if the instance tracks confidential projects, customer data, incidents, or security vulnerabilities. Mitigation focus: Upgrade Redmine to 2.6.9, 3.0.7, 3.1.3, or a later supported release.; Apply Debian DSA-3529 updates where Redmine is installed from Debian packages.; Restrict Atom feed access until fixed versions are deployed..
